Observed Gaits

Walk
A 4-beat gait in which each leg steps sequentially
Trot
The trot is a two-beat diagonal gait where the diagonal pairs of legs move forward at the same time with a moment of suspension between each beat.
Canter
The canter is a controlled, three-beat gait, faster than most horses' trot but slower than the gallop.
